What is Autodesk Ecotect Analysis 2011 and How to Use It
Autodesk Ecotect Analysis 2011 is a software application that allows you to perform environmental analysis and simulation on your building designs. It helps you to optimize your design for energy efficiency, thermal comfort, daylighting, acoustics, and more. You can use it to evaluate your design from the early conceptual stage to the detailed design stage.
Autodesk Ecotect Analysis 2011 has a user-friendly interface that integrates with Autodesk Revit and AutoCAD. You can import your 3D models from these applications or create them directly in Ecotect. You can also import data in gbXML format from other applications[^1^]. Ecotect allows you to visualize and analyze your model in various ways, such as:
Shading and solar analysis: You can see how your building is affected by the sun and shadows throughout the year. You can also calculate solar radiation and solar access on any surface of your model.
Thermal analysis: You can simulate the heat transfer and air flow in your building and see how it affects the indoor temperature and humidity. You can also calculate heating and cooling loads and energy consumption.
Daylighting analysis: You can assess the natural lighting levels and quality in your building and see how it affects the visual comfort and energy demand. You can also calculate daylight factors and illuminance values on any surface of your model.
Acoustic analysis: You can evaluate the sound propagation and noise levels in your building and see how it affects the acoustic comfort and privacy. You can also calculate reverberation times and sound pressure levels on any surface of your model.
If you have a subscription to Autodesk Ecotect Analysis, you can also access the Autodesk Green Building Studio web-based service, which allows you to conduct whole building energy, water, and carbon analysis[^2^]. You can use this service to compare different design alternatives, optimize your design for performance and cost, and generate reports and documentation.

How to Use Autodesk Ecotect Analysis 2011
To use Autodesk Ecotect Analysis 2011, you need to follow these steps:
Launch the software and create a new project or open an existing one.
Import or create your 3D model of your building. You can use the modeling tools in Ecotect or import your model from Autodesk Revit or AutoCAD. You can also import data in gbXML format from other applications.
Define the project settings and parameters, such as the location, climate, orientation, units, and materials of your building. You can use the default values or customize them according to your needs.
Select the analysis type and mode that you want to perform on your model. You can choose from shading and solar analysis, thermal analysis, daylighting analysis, or acoustic analysis. You can also select the level of detail and accuracy that you want for your analysis.
Run the analysis and view the results. You can see the results in various forms, such as graphs, charts, tables, maps, images, or animations. You can also export the results to other formats or applications for further processing or documentation.
Interpret the results and make design changes accordingly. You can use the feedback and recommendations from Ecotect to improve your design for environmental performance and comfort. You can also compare different design scenarios and options using Ecotect.
